Elon University helped welcome nurses, physician assistants and physical therapists to their new health care careers on Friday, Dec. 9, during the 2022 School of Health Sciences Commencement Ceremony held in Alumni Gym.

A member of the Doctor of Physical Therapy Class of 2022 receives a hood during the School of Health Sciences Commencement December 9, 2022, at Alumni Gym.

The joint graduation ceremony saw students in the Accelerated Bachelor of Science in Nursing, Physician Assistant Studies and Doctor of Physical Therapy programs cross the stage to receive their diplomas. They were met at the conclusion of their rigorous academic pursuits with the resounding applause and cheers of friends and family members gathered to celebrate their accomplishments and wish them well as they begin new career paths.

Friday’s ceremony saw Elon graduate its first future nurses, with 14 students in the 16-month Accelerated Bachelor of Science in Nursing (ABSN) program receiving the university’s first nursing degree diplomas. The program was launched in 2021 along with a traditional four-year bachelor of science in nursing program within the School of Health Sciences.

“As graduates, you could not have arrived at a better time,” Stephen Folger, interim dean of the School of Health Sciences, told the students. “The United States and global societies need Elon School of Health Sciences graduates and leaders to face the challenges of today and tomorrow as we strive to reduce health care inequities and optimize patient outcomes.”

Elon’s ABSN program is designed for students who have already obtained a bachelor’s degree who want to enter the field of nursing. The program’s curriculum focuses on community-based population health, the reduction of health disparities and the use of health informatics to optimize outcomes. Students complete 65 credit hours of academic work along with at least 540 hours of clinical work and upon their graduation are prepared to sit for their nursing licensing exams.

Students in Elon’s Physician Assistant Studies program complete the full-time program in 24 months, with the first year focused on academic work in the classroom and lab and the second year spent learning in clinical environments including those focused on primary care, pediatrics, emergency medicine, inpatient medicine, surgery, women’s health and behavioral medicine. Students complete a master’s project that supports and promotes professional development in the area of accessing, critically appraising and applying the best available evidence to address a research, patient care or policy question relevant to physician assistant practice or education.

A new graduate poses for pictures following the School of Health Sciences Commencement December 9, 2022, at Alumni Gym.

The three-year Doctor of Physical Therapy program emphasizes a patient-centered approach to the profession with a curriculum that immerses students in science and research while teaching them the value of respect and communication. Students build upon the solid academic experience they obtain in the classroom with 40 weeks of hands-on clinical practicums, which is higher than the national average for similar programs. Students spend the final 16 weeks of the program in clinical practicum at sites across the United States.

Diet and nutrition are important drivers of cardiovascular disease (CVDs) and type 2 diabetes (T2D).

The American Heart Association recommends diets high in antioxidants, vitamins, and minerals and low in saturated fat and sodium to reduce CVD and T2D risk.

Further research into micronutrients is crucial for personalizing preventive strategies for CVDs and T2D.

In a recent study, researchers reviewed 884 randomized controlled trials to assess the link between micronutrients and cardiometabolic risk.

While some micronutrients reduced cardiometabolic risk, others had a neutral effect. Beta-carotene, however, increased CVD risk.

The study was published in the Journal of the American College of Cardiology.

For the study, the researchers analyzed 884 studies with a total of 883,627 participants.

Data included micronutrient supplementation; nine measures of cardiometabolic risk factors covering blood pressure, blood lipids, and blood sugar levels, and a range of outcome measures including cardiovascular events, diagnosis of T2D, and mortality from stroke, heart disease, and all-cause mortality.

From their analysis, they found that several micronutrients improved at least two of the nine CVD risk factor measures based on moderate to high quality studies. These included:

  • omega-3 fatty acid
  • omega-6 fatty acid
  • L-arginine
  • L-citrulline
  • folic acid
  • magnesium
  • zinc
  • alpha lipoic acid
  • coenzyme Q10
  • Anthocyanin
  • curcumin
  • genistein
  • quercetin

They noted that omega-3 fatty acid supplements decreased CVD mortality, heart attacks, and other heart diseases, while folic acid reduced strokes.

Meanwhile, vitamin C, vitamin D, vitamin E, and selenium had no effect on CVD events such as heart attack, arrhythmia or stroke, or diagnosis of T2D and had no impact on longer-term outcomes such as cardiovascular mortality.

They further found that while omega-3 fatty acids, omega-6 fatty acids, vitamin E, and beta carotene were not linked to T2D incidence, an analysis of 10 polyphenols found moderate quality evidence for a reduction in HbA1c (a measure of longer-term blood sugar levels) for coenzyme Q10 and reduction in fasting blood insulin levels for flavanol, genistein, and quercetin. There was high quality evidence for similar reductions in insulin levels for curcumin.

Beta-carotene supplements, however, were linked to an increased risk of all-cause mortality, CVD mortality, and a reduction in the number of strokes.

To understand how the different micronutrients studied may affect cardiometabolic health, Medical News Today spoke with Dr. Debbie Fetter, assistant professor in teaching nutrition at the University of California Davis, who was not involved in the study.

“[Nutrients like vitamin C, vitamin E, and beta carotene] function as antioxidants, which helps protect body cells from oxidative damage. […] Antioxidants help prevent the cell membrane from weakening so that carcinogens or rogue compounds can’t get inside. We can think of antioxidants as [molecules] that protect us from oxidative damage that may lead indirectly to diet-related chronic disease, like CVD.”
— Dr. Debbie Fetter

Dr. Fetter explained that omega-3 fatty acids play an important role in the brain, heart, and immune system, as well as metabolism. She noted that research indicates omega-3 intake may lower CVD risk via an anti-inflammatory effect.

She further noted that vitamin D reduces oxidative stress, which improves cardiometabolic outcomes, but that research is still inconclusive as to whether it helps prevent CVD.

“Magnesium is another essential nutrient that plays a role in muscle and nerve function. Our heart is a muscle, so adequate magnesium is needed to keep our heart properly functioning (i.e. contractions and rhythm),” she added.

Beta-carotene is a plant pigment that gives vegetables and fruits their red, orange, and yellow colors.

To understand what might explain the observed effects of beta-carotene on cardiometabolic risk, MNT spoke with Dr. Ronald Grifka, Chief Medical Officer at the University of Michigan Health-West, not involved in the study. He noted that several factors might be involved:

“One factor may be the patients did not have a deficiency, and the excessive intake of beta-carotene resulted in the higher mortality. Also, beta-carotene may have a different effect on male and female patients and on those who are smokers or drinkers. Combining data from multiple studies do not control for these variables, making it difficult to interpret the results.”

Dr. Fetter stressed that beta-carotene can be beneficial when consumed as a part of food. However, she added that research has shown it is often harmful when a part of a supplement.

She noted that one study found that beta-carotene supplements increased the risk of lung cancer and overall mortality in smokers.

“This is a classic example of where we see benefits from getting the nutrient from the whole food, but when we isolate the nutrient and put it into supplement form, we see adverse consequences,” she said.

Dr. Nurgul Fitzgerald, associate professor in nutrition and public health at Rutgers University, who was not involved in the study, told MNT:

“A potential mechanism might have to do with the antioxidant properties of beta-carotene. Under certain conditions, antioxidants can become pro-oxidant – creating the opposite, harmful effect.”

“Beta-carotene supplementation is linked to increased risk of lung cancer, especially among high risk segments of the population such as smokers. If you consider that smoking is also a cardiovascular disease risk by itself, the supplementation might be compounding the risk there.”
— Dr. Nurgul Fitzgerald

The researchers concluded that some but not all micronutrients might benefit cardiometabolic health.

When asked about the study’s limitations, Dr. Fitzgerald noted that it is difficult to directly transfer these results to everyday lives due to the variety of dietary combinations.

“Some nutrients work better or worse when we consume them in certain amounts or consume them with other nutrients. Nutrients can have synergistic effects on one another, and other components in our foods can hinder the absorption of some of the nutrients.”

She added that the United States and other countries regularly add vitamins or minerals to certain foods meaning that the effects of supplementation might vary among different countries.

Dr. Grifka added that the studies assessed different doses of various micronutrients over varying periods of time, which could have resulted in ‘markedly’ different effects.

“If several micronutrients are included in a patient’s daily consumption, one micronutrient may offset the effect of the other or amplify the effect of another, further confusing the clinical results,” he continued.

“It would be important to identify the specific dosages and individual participants’ characteristics to better understand the findings,” Dr. Fetter concluded.

A recent systematic review published in the journal JAMA Dermatology synthesized data from previous research, including randomized clinical trials, on nutritional supplements that could treat hair loss.

The study found that an array of supplements ranging from pumpkin seed oil, zinc, vitamin E, omega fatty acids, and certain commercial formulations like Viviscal and Nutrafol, among others, showed promise in the treatment of specific types of hair loss.

The studies included in the review were generally small and used subjective inclusion criteria, emphasizing the need for larger, more robust randomized clinical trials.

The hair growth cycle can be divided into three phases. The first phase, known as anagen, is characterized by the growth of hair and can last several years.

Around 85–90{cfdf3f5372635aeb15fd3e2aecc7cb5d7150695e02bd72e0a44f1581164ad809} of hair follicles in a normal scalp are in the anagen or growth phase. The growth phase is followed by catagen, the transition phase involving the slowing of hair growth.

The catagen phase lasts about 14 days and is followed by the telogen or resting phase which lasts 3–4 months. Hair growth remains dormant during the resting phase and is followed by hair shedding. A loss of about 50–100 hair strands normally occurs every day.

Hair shedding in excess of these normal values is referred to as hair loss or alopecia.

Hair loss can occur due to many reasons, including genetics, aging, autoimmune disease, hormonal changes, and stress. Some of the common types of hair loss include androgenetic alopecia, alopecia areata, and telogen effluvium.

Androgenetic alopecia, referred to as pattern baldness, is the most common cause of hair loss that is estimated to affect 50{cfdf3f5372635aeb15fd3e2aecc7cb5d7150695e02bd72e0a44f1581164ad809} of men and women by the time they reach the age of 50 years. Alopecia areata, another common form of hair loss, is an autoimmune disease that results in the loss of small patches of hair.

Telogen effluvium is characterized by hair follicles prematurely exiting the growth phase and entering the telogen phase. This results in excessive shedding of hair in the resting phase.

Telogen effluvium often appears in response to stress, illness, or the use of medications.

Treatment of hair loss generally requires addressing the underlying cause, such as nutritional deficiency or disease. There are also Food and Drug Administration (FDA)-approved medications for androgenetic alopecia, namely oral finasteride and topical minoxidil.

Due to the potential negative effects of finasteride in females, only minoxidil is also used for androgenetic alopecia in females.

However, both drugs are associated with adverse effects that may result in the discontinuation of their use. Specifically, finasteride can cause sexual dysfunction in men, whereas minoxidil is associated with dermatitis.

More recently, the FDA also approved baricitinib, a drug that modulates the immune system, for the treatment of severe alopecia areata.

Given the potential side effects associated with pharmacological treatments, there has been an interest in the use of alternative therapies, including nutritional supplements, for hair loss.

A recent study involving patients from a hair loss clinic showed that nearly 80{cfdf3f5372635aeb15fd3e2aecc7cb5d7150695e02bd72e0a44f1581164ad809} of individuals used nutritional supplements. However, there are limited data on the safety and efficacy of these supplements.

In the present study, the researchers summarized evidence from 30 prior human studies, including 17 randomized clinical trials, examining the effectiveness of various nutritional supplements in the treatment of hair loss.

They excluded studies involving hair loss due to nutritional deficiency, use of medications, trauma, or physical stress.

The researchers also categorized the studies according to the quality of evidence, with randomized clinical trials representing the highest level of evidence in the review.

Studies suggest that various types of hair loss, including alopecia areata, androgenetic alopecia, and telogen effluvium, are associated with oxidative stress and a deficiency of micronutrients such as vitamins.

While the review found some high-quality evidence to suggest that zinc could enhance hair growth in individuals with hair loss, evidence supporting a role for vitamin D and vitamin B12 in the treatment of hair loss was of lower quality.

Although biotin (vitamin B7) is a common ingredient in hair loss therapies, there was an absence of studies examining the effects of biotin as a standalone treatment.

However, results from randomized clinical trials suggest that tocotrienols, antioxidant compounds belonging to the vitamin E family, and a combination of fish oil (omega-3 and omega-6), blackcurrant seed oil, and antioxidants such as vitamin E and lycopene, could improve hair density in individuals with hair loss.

Androgenetic alopecia is associated with the excessive response of hair follicles to an androgen called dihydrotestosterone (DHT), which is derived from testosterone.

Among nutritional supplements that inhibit the formation of DHT, data from a randomized clinical trial suggests that pumpkin seed oil could stimulate hair growth in men.

A deficiency of other hormones, such as insulin-like growth factor-1 (IGF-1), is also associated with hair loss. Studies suggest that capsaicin, the active ingredient in chili peppers, and isoflavones, a subclass of antioxidant compounds, could potentially increase the levels of insulin-like growth factor-1.

In addition, a small randomized clinical trial showed that capsaicin and isoflavones together can enhance hair growth in individuals with alopecia.

Plant-based compounds that can modulate the immune response, such as glycyrrhizin (licorice) and extracts from the peony plant, have also shown promise in the treatment of individuals with alopecia areata, which is characterized by an immune response against hair follicles.

Similarly, studies also suggest that procyanidin B-2, an anti-inflammatory and antioxidant compound, derived from certain apple species, can also stimulate hair growth.

Multi-ingredient commercial formulations including Pantogar, Nourkrin, Viviscal, Nutrafol, and Lambdapil have also shown positive effects on hair growth in randomized clinical trials.

Pantogar includes keratin, the major protein in hair, and its building block L-cysteine, which could help promote hair growth.

Viviscal and Nourkirn contain proteins derived from marine animals that can facilitate hair growth. Nutrafol contains DHT synthesis blockers, antioxidants, and anti-inflammatory compounds, whereas Lambdapil contains L-cysteine, plant-derived silicon, and DHT synthesis blockers.

There is a lack of sufficient or high-quality evidence to support the role of other multi-ingredient commercial formulations such as Omni-Three and FORTI-5 in stimulating hair growth.

Besides having beneficial effects on hair growth, the interventions reviewed in the current study generally had mild side effects. These results suggest that nutritional supplements could potentially help treat certain types of hair loss.

However, the authors noted that the studies included in the review had several limitations. For instance, a majority of studies had a small sample size or used subjective reports of hair loss at baseline.

The authors also cautioned that some of the studies included in the review were funded by manufacturers of the nutritional supplements

The authors further noted concerns about the lack of FDA regulations that cover the efficacy, safety, and quality of supplements. Thus, nutritional supplements could potentially contain inefficacious or adulterated ingredients, with the latter resulting in side effects.

This requires dermatologists to work with patients to weigh the risks and benefits of such nutritional supplements.

Dr. Justin Rome, founder of the Barber Surgeons Guild, commented for Medical News Today that:

“While nutritional deficiencies can lead to hair loss, supplementation of vitamins such as biotin to those who are not deficient has not been shown to promote hair growth. Other novel ingredients may have a beneficial result in certain circumstances; however, they also may have no result or worse, potential adverse effects. It is important to note that nutritional supplements are not regulated by the FDA, which means they do not undergo the rigorous safety and efficacy testing as medications.”

Similarly, Dr. Thivi Maruthappu, consultant dermatologist at the Cadogan Clinic and lecturer in nutrition science, cautioned:

“Be careful when choosing supplements, look for high-quality clinical trials supporting their use. High doses of certain nutrients can actually be harmful for example excess Selenium, can lead to toxicity and even worsen hair shedding, and high dose biotin can trigger acne and interfere with blood tests, so it’s important to do your research before you buy.”
